Handheld vs Pad for Work: Which is Right for You?

Choosing the ideal device for work can be a struggle. Both handsets and pads offer advantages, but which one best meets your needs?

Smartphones are incredibly portable, allowing you to stay online on the go. Their adaptability means they can handle tasks like emails, surfing the web, and even light editing.

Tablets, however, excel in areas requiring larger screens. Their greater screen real estate makes them ideal for consuming documents, demonstrating content, and creative tasks.

Consider your work needs.

* Do you frequently need to be on the move?

* What type of tasks do you primarily perform?

* How important is screen size for your workflow?

Answering these questions will help you determine whether a handset or pad is the right tool for your work.

Tablet or Slate? A Look at Mobile Office Essentials

The modern workforce is increasingly mobile, relying on smartphones and tablets to stay productive on the go. But which device reigns supreme for tackling office tasks? Both handsets and pads offer distinct advantages. Smartphones, with their compact size and always-on connectivity, are perfect for quick checks, emails, and conference calls. However, they can feel cramped for more demanding tasks like document editing or spreadsheet manipulation. Tablets, on the other hand, boast larger screens and a more ergonomic typing experience, making them ideal for extended work sessions. Ultimately, the best choice depends on your individual needs and workflow.

  • Evaluate your most frequent office tasks.
  • Weigh the screen size and portability of each device.
  • Purchase accessories like keyboard cases or styluses for enhanced productivity.

Top Smartphone Features for Business Users

When selecting a cell phone for work purposes, it's crucial to consider features that enhance productivity and optimize your workflow. A reliable and durable phone with a robust battery life is essential for staying connected throughout the workday. Choose a phone with ample storage space to manage important files, documents, and applications. A high-resolution display will provide clear visibility for reading emails, reports, and presentations.

  • Consider a phone with advanced security features such as encryption and biometric authentication to protect sensitive information.
  • A fast processor and ample RAM will enable seamless multitasking and quick app launching.
  • Select a phone that offers excellent call quality and a stable internet connection for productive communication.
